Of course, I'm joining because I am familiar with the greatest "fake" pokemon game in existence. But because of this (black) marketing scheme and my naivety as a child, I came to discover this strangely addicting series and be very fortunate enough to own a hard copy of one of the games!

It all goes back to the year when pokemon ruby and sapphire were going to be released. I was a young, healthy pokemon-loving child on vacation in Hong Kong China for three weeks. So one day I was walking through a flea market and something crossed my eye - I saw (what I thought would be) pokemon ruby on a rickety old shelf a week before it was going to be released in North America. Back when you're a child you tend to believe China and Japan to be the countries with the best technologies and the newest gadgets so I never really thought much of it being a fake copy.

So I begged my mom to buy it for me, she asked the vendor if it was in english, and he said yes, and allowed me to play it for a bit to find out myself. So I popped it in my gba. And what I saw, was NOTHING like pokemon, but, as a child I just figured it was gamefreak going in a completely different direction. Not to mention the title screen did say "Pocket Monster Ruby". And it was true, it was in english - mangled and confusing english though....So I shrugged my shoulders and my mom bought it. I eventually bought the real pokemon ruby, back in Canada.

I've had "Pocket Monster ruby" ever since....For like, 5 years now though I've never really thought much of it ever since I got stuck.
I've just recently pulled it back out because of someone on another forum talking about fake pokemon games. Now I know what this awesome series is actually called, and now I'm on a quest to completing "pocket monster ruby" or, as it should be called, telefang 2 power version!
